Eventually, the Yanme'e became an interstellar-faring, [[Technological Achievement Tiers#Tier 4: Space Age|Tier-4]] species. The Yanme'e first encountered the [[Covenant]] in the year [[1112]], while the Covenant was searching for Forerunner artifacts.<ref>'''Halo Encyclopedia: The Definitive Guide to the Halo Universe''', ''page 159'' (2011 edition)</ref> Initially, first contact was violent as the Yanme'e attempted to resist the alien invaders. Both sides took heavy casualties, but surprisingly,{{Ref/Reuse|bestiarum}} it was the Covenant who fared worse in these battles due to the sheer amount of Yanme'e combatants.{{Ref/Reuse|ENC}} However, the Covenant was unwilling to [[glassing|glass]] Palamok, as the [[San'Shyuum]] believed that Palamok's hives could be guarding Forerunner relics on the planet's surface. The San'Shyuum eventually found an effective way to communicate with the Yanme'e, and subsequently incorporated them into the Covenant by way of a treaty in an effort to prevent a prolonged war. The Yanme'e were one of the first species to make contact with [[humanity]], on the human colony of [[Harvest]] in [[2525|February 2525]]. After the [[Hierarchs]] declared war on humanity, Yanme'e were used as military combatants against UNSC forces. They were deployed during many major conflicts, including the [[Fall of Reach]]. During the [[Battle of Meridian]], five or six Yanme'e were deployed by an {{Pattern|Ceudar|heavy corvette}} to finish off the survivors of a boat it had fired upon. [[Dorian Nguyen]] was able to kill one by slamming it with a guitar, crumpling its wings and sending the Yanme'e into the sea.
